#72151d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#72151d is composed of 44.7% red, 8.2% green and 11.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 81.6% magenta, 74.6% yellow and 55.3% black. It has a hue angle of 354.8 degrees, a saturation of 68.9% and a lightness of 26.5%. #72151d color hex could be obtained by blending #e42a3a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660033.

Shades and Tints of #72151d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0304 is the darkest color, while #fffd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#72151d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#483f3f is the less saturated color, while #87000c is the most saturated one.
